Joignez notre réseau de talents

Développeur - Développement de solutions numériques (.NET MAUI) - 36598

Lieu: TORONTO, ONTARIO, CANADA
Date de début d'affichage: 5 nov. 2024
Date de fin d'affichage: 8 nov. 2024

Partager:

Description de poste

Description

Appartenir à Air Canada, c’est appartenir à un symbole canadien, Air Canada récemment élue meilleur transporteur aérien en Amérique du Nord. Faites décoller votre carrière en vous joignant à notre équipe novatrice et diversifiée à l’avant-garde du transport aérien de passagers.

En tant que développeur .NET, vous serez responsable de la conception, du développement, de la mise à l’essai et du déploiement d’applications mobiles à l’aide de .NET MAUI. Vous collaborerez étroitement avec les intervenants commerciaux afin de comprendre leurs exigences et les convertir en solutions modulables et faciles à gérer.

Ce poste relève du chef de service – Développement de solutions numériques.

Responsabilités:

  • Concevoir, développer et tenir à jour des applications .NET de haute qualité au moyen de MAUI.
  • Collaborer avec des équipes interfonctionnelles dans le but de définir, concevoir et mettre sur le marché de nouvelles fonctionnalités.
  • Veiller au rendement, à la qualité et à la réactivité des applications.
  • Déterminer et corriger les goulots d’étranglement et les bogues.
  • Contribuer au maintien de la qualité, de l’organisation et de l’automatisation du code.
  • Participer à l’examen du code et fournir de la rétroaction constructive aux membres de l’équipe.
  • Se tenir au courant des dernières tendances et technologies de l’industrie pour s’assurer que nos solutions demeurent de pointe.

Qualifications

  • Baccalauréat en informatique, en ingénierie ou dans un domaine connexe
  • De cinq à six années d’expérience en développement .NET
  • Solide expérience de MAUI (Multi-platform App UI)
  • Maîtrise de C#, .NET Core et .NET Framework
  • Expérience des interfaces de programmation d’applications de transfert d’état représentationnel (REST) et des services Web
  • Connaissance des technologies frontales, comme HTML, CSS et JavaScript
  • Excellente compréhension des principes de la programmation orientée objet
  • Expérience des systèmes de gestion de versions, comme Git
  • Excellentes compétences en résolution de problèmes et souci du détail
  • Habileté marquée pour la communication et le travail d’équipe

Compétences souhaitables :

  • Expérience des plateformes infonuagiques comme Azure ou AWS
  • Connaissance du développement d’applications mobiles pour iOS et Android
  • Connaissance des méthodologies Agile et Scrum
  • Expérience des pipelines d’intégration et de livraison continues

Conditions d’emploi :

  • Les candidats doivent avoir le droit de travailler dans le pays choisi au moment où un emploi leur est offert. Il incombe entièrement aux employés posant leur candidature d’obtenir les permis de travail, les visas ou toutes autres autorisationsrequises pour le poste.

Exigences Linguistiques

À compétences égales, la préférence sera accordée aux candidats bilingues.

Diversité et inclusion

Air Canada est résolument engagée en faveur de la diversité et de l’inclusion et vise à créer un milieu de travail sain, accessible et gratifiant qui met en valeur la contribution unique de nos employés au succès de notre entreprise.

En tant qu'employeur qui garantit l'égalité d'accès à l'emploi, nous encourageons les candidatures les plus diverses afin de pouvoir nous doter d’un effectif varié et représentatif de nos clients et des communautés où nous vivons et offrons nos services.

Air Canada remercie tous les candidats de leur intérêt, mais seules les personnes sélectionnées pour une entrevue seront contactées.

Partager: